Resumo

This research aims at understanding in what sense the area tutoring continuing education, called area tutoring, can be understood as a possibility of constitution of the subject teacher regarding the care of himself. The area tutoring is a methodology of in-service training offered to the teacher with the objective of improving his classroom practice through reflection in his daily basis activities. Thus, the tutor must establish a partnership with the teacher, in the sense of helping him to know himself and also to diagnose his difficulties and only then propose some type of training. Hense, he (the tutor) figures as a master of self-care that leads the teacher to take care of himself so as he takes care of the other (student). As for me, the aspects mentioned above may be analogous to Foucault's "Hermeneutics of the Subject" (2010). This is a qualitative research of a documental nature. In it, the discursive practices proposed in a publication made available by the Itaú Social Foundation to the Department of Education of Goiás, called Tutorial Strategy Videos (2014c), are considered. From the transcription of the speeches of the videos, the utterances were submitted to a discursive analysis, which is a very specific method of the Discourse Analysis of French orientation. This method is characterized as a reading theory whose instrumental apparatus makes possible to understand the discourse, the teaching and the subject. The epistemological bases of Discourse Analysis take into account the contributions of Pêcheux (1990), taken up and extended in Orlandi (2002 and 2006), Maldidier (2003), Maingueneau and Charaudeau (2006), Gregolin (2004), Navarro among others. For the analysis of the subject's constitution with his own self-care, the assumptions of Foucault (2010), and the dialogical interaction in Bakhtin (1995, 2003) and Vygotsky (1991) are considered. Regarding continuing education, the studies of Gatti (2008), Vieira (2011), Freire (1997) and Geraldi (2016) are considered. The results, based on the discursive analysis, show that the in-service training in loco, through its principles, enables the insertion of the teacher as an active subject in the training process. The conclusion of this research is that this training model, based on interaction as well as on the reflective and reflexive actions, contributes more deeply to the construction of meanings. That happens both on the teacher's identity and on the teaching-learning process due to the way the education takes place. It is given the teacher the opportunity to be constituted in a more ethical and moral way because he starts to have the autonomy to work on his subjectivity from a true discourse and, from this, define his practices and his way of being.
